Miao Li is a scholar working on Molecular Biology, Biomedical Engineering and Materials Chemistry. According to data from OpenAlex, Miao Li has authored 54 papers receiving a total of 1.6k indexed citations (citations by other indexed papers that have themselves been cited), including 18 papers in Molecular Biology, 16 papers in Biomedical Engineering and 9 papers in Materials Chemistry. Recurrent topics in Miao Li’s work include Nanoplatforms for cancer theranostics (8 papers), Advanced biosensing and bioanalysis techniques (6 papers) and RNA Interference and Gene Delivery (5 papers). Miao Li is often cited by papers focused on Nanoplatforms for cancer theranostics (8 papers), Advanced biosensing and bioanalysis techniques (6 papers) and RNA Interference and Gene Delivery (5 papers). Miao Li collaborates with scholars based in China, United States and Italy. Miao Li's co-authors include Jiangli Fan, Xiaojun Peng, Yiguang Jin, Wen Sun and Jianjun Du and has published in prestigious journals such as Accounts of Chemical Research, ACS Nano and Biomaterials.
